Frequently Asked Questions about Skokie
How much are Studio apartments in Skokie?
There are currently 399 Studio Apartments in Skokie with rent ranges from $1,050 to $3,426 with an average price of $2,128.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Skokie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Skokie ranges from $1,225 to $5,697 with an average monthly rent of $2,461.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Skokie c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Skokie range from $1,400 to $7,628.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,042.
How expensive are Skokie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 278 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Skokie on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,750 to $13,015 - averaging $3,663 for the location.
